あんぽり
noun
UN Security Council (abbreviation)
1. UN Security Council
An abbreviation of 国連安全保障理事会. The principal organ of the United Nations responsible for international peace and security. Consists of five permanent members with veto power and ten rotating non-permanent members.
安保理(あんぽり)決議(けつぎ)採択(さいたく)された。
A resolution was adopted at the Security Council.
安保理(あんぽり)緊急(きんきゅう)会合(かいごう)(ひら)かれた。
An emergency meeting of the Security Council was held.
日本(にほん)安保理(あんぽり)非常任(ひじょうにん)理事国(りじこく)選出(せんしゅつ)されたことが何度(なんど)もある。
Japan has been elected as a non-permanent member of the Security Council numerous times.

USAGE:
The standard abbreviation used in news reporting. The full form 国連(こくれん)安全(あんぜん)保障(ほしょう)理事会(りじかい) is used in formal or first-mention contexts.

FULL FORM:

  • 国連(こくれん)安全(あんぜん)保障(ほしょう)理事会(りじかい) (United Nations Security Council)

COMMON COLLOCATIONS:

  • 安保理(あんぽり)決議(けつぎ) (Security Council resolution)
  • 安保理(あんぽり)常任(じょうにん)理事国(りじこく) (permanent member of the Security Council)
  • 安保理(あんぽり)改革(かいかく) (Security Council reform)
